Physical Treatment to Enhance Balance and also Inner Ear Concerns
Vestibular rehabilitation is a sort of physical therapy that can profit people with internal ear or equilibrium troubles. It helps your brain discover ways to make use of various other detects (such as vision) to compensate for vertigo.
The workouts are normally tailored to satisfy a person’s individual needs. They might include eye as well as head movements, equilibrium training, or various other maneuvers, depending upon what’s creating your signs.
Vestibular recovery is typically done on an outpatient basis, however it can also be performed in a medical facility or residence setup.
Canalith Repositioning, Likewise Referred To As the Epley Maneuver
Canalith repositioning, additionally referred to as the Epley maneuver, is a method that entails a series of unique head as well as body movements.
The objective is to relocate crystals from the fluid-filled semicircular canals of your inner ear to a various location, so they can be soaked up by the body.
Canalith repositioning entails the following steps:
You sit on an test table with your eyes open as well as your head transformed 45 degrees to the right.
You push your back rapidly with your head hanging off the end of the table.
Your medical professional transforms your head 90 degrees to the left, and you hold this position for regarding 30 secs.
Your physician transforms your head another 90 levels to the left while you turn your body in the same direction. This position is held for one more 30 seconds.
You stay up on the left side of the exam table.
The procedure can be repeated on both sides up until you feel alleviation.
You’ll probably have signs of vertigo throughout your therapy. You may need to continue to be upright for 24-hour following your procedure to avoid crystals from returning to the semicircular canals.
A medical professional or physiotherapist usually performs canalith repositioning, yet you might be demonstrated how to do customized exercises in your home.

Canalith repositioning is really effective for people with benign paroxysmal positional vertigo (BPPV)– one of the most usual source of vertigo. Outcomes vary, yet research reveals an approximate success price of 70 percent on the first attempt and also virtually one hundred percent on succeeding efforts. (2 )
If the crystals return into your semicircular canals, your medical professional can duplicate the therapy.
You need to tell your doctor if you have any of the adhering to prior to having this therapy:
A neck problem
A back problem
Rheumatoid arthritis
A removed retina in your eye
Capillary or heart problems.
Drug That Targets the Source Of Your Symptoms.
Numerous medicines are used to help enhance signs of vertigo. Medications are normally a lot more reliable at dealing with vertigo that lasts a couple of hours to several days.
Individuals with Ménière’s illness may gain from taking diuretics, medications that assist your body eliminate salt, water, as well as the demand to restrict salt in your diet plan.
If your vertigo is triggered by an infection, anti-biotics or steroids may be provided.

Surgery: an Unusual Therapy for Diplomatic Immunities.
Surgical procedure isn’t a usual treatment for vertigo, yet it’s often needed.
You might call for a surgery if your signs are brought on by an hidden problem, such as a lump or an injury to your mind or neck.
In unusual situations, physicians might recommend canal plugging surgical treatment for people with BPPV when various other therapies stop working. With this procedure, a bone plug is used to obstruct an area of your internal ear as well as prevent the semicircular canals from replying to fragment movements. The success rate is around 90 percent. (3 ).
An additional surgical procedure, called labyrinthectomy, disables the vestibular maze in your bad ear and also enables the other ear to regulate equilibrium. This procedure is seldom done but may be recommended if you have considerable hearing loss or vertigo that hasn’t replied to various other treatments.
Seldom, people with Meniere’s illness might also call for surgery, such as a shunt surgical treatment, to aid signs and symptoms.
A procedure to plug a leak in the inner ear is sometimes made use of for individuals with perilymph fistula.
Other surgeries may be required, relying on what’s creating your vertigo episodes.
Injections: When Various Other Therapies Haven’t Functioned.
In cases in which clients have actually not responded to other therapies, shots are often used to aid individuals with vertigo signs. The antibiotic gentamicin (Garamycin) can be injected into your inner ear to disable balance. This allows the unaffected ear to carry out balance functions.

In Some Cases Vertigo Goes Away All by itself.
Your vertigo may go away by itself, without any details therapy. For example, individuals with BPPV frequently see that their symptoms vanish within a couple of weeks or months. (3 ).
Your physician can assist you identify if therapy is needed for your problem.
